Pros

Very good pay! 12 hour shifts, so we really only work 14 days a month. Better than average benefits for the area. Experience will transfer to another job with similar requirements.

Cons

This is a male led plant/position. of the roughly 40 operators, theres usually only 2 females actually working on plant. Needs of females, for example privacy, are not remedied quickly. A large majority of the males aren't used to working with females in that type of environment and are hesitant to do such, acting differently around a female than they would a male.

Pros

-large company -relatively stable -good benefits -lots of locations -large product offering of all brands and varieties -newer facilities at retail -heavy focus on safety

Cons

-no real strategy in place to grow the business -weak employees seem to be promoted and kept - employee turnover is huge, right now there are 45 jobs unfilled - company culture is depressing. No kind of motivational or inspirational events to make employees feel like part of a progressive team. - everyone is left to themselves to train and learn about company systems and processes. - all focus is on margins and share value with little to no focus on the customers.

Pros

Amazing benefits, great experience, lots of opportunity, good pay and incentive If they allow wprk from home it creates a great work life balance. But if they push for everyone to go back to the office the balance is not existent. You will work 12 hour days and go home exhausted.

Cons

The new CEO doesn't listen to the employees. When you have entry level up to director level saying that working from home is working better for their teams, you should really listen and stop forcing your power trip. Pushing everyone back into the office immediately, after 16 mo of telling us it will be a slow transition has caused a lot of frustration. Add in the "Finance Transformation", constant projects and competing priorities and you are creating a hostile work environment for good employees.
